A retailer in the south of the Island has announced it's closing down.
Torden Stores in Port St Mary says it's in the process of selling all stock and heavier items.
The owners say it's not been an easy decision, and they will cherish the memories from the last five years.
The store will be opening between Monday and Thursday for the next two weeks.
